10 valuable websites for entrepreneurs in 2022 (all free) 👇
unsplash.com
Need images for your website, app, or pitch deck?
Look no further than Unsplash.
Browse an extensive catalog of free images.
With Getty Images running upwards of $499(!) each,
Unsplash will save you thousands.
similarweb.com
Analyze your competitor landscape.
Type in the name of a competitor in the search.
Uncover:
• Traffic sources
• Where they are advertising
• Similar sites
• Much more
There’s a paid version too, but v_Free will take you far.

Linktr.ee
Use Linktree to sell products from a social media bio link.
Here’s how it works:
• Create a simple one-page Linktree site
• Add product links to the site (affiliate or your own)
• Put the Linktree URL in bio
• Monetize social media accounts

Zapier.com
Automate your workflow by connecting two apps.
For example, I use Zapier to connect:
Twitter’s Revue Form (at the top of my profile) ➜ ConvertKit (email marketing platform).
First 100 tasks/month are free.
You'll save 4+ hrs per week.
